Rocío Bengoechea is a scholar working on Molecular Biology, Cellular and Molecular Neuroscience and Genetics. According to data from OpenAlex, Rocío Bengoechea has authored 25 papers receiving a total of 819 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 24 papers in Molecular Biology, 6 papers in Cellular and Molecular Neuroscience and 6 papers in Genetics. Recurrent topics in Rocío Bengoechea’s work include RNA Research and Splicing (12 papers), Muscle Physiology and Disorders (8 papers) and Heat shock proteins research (6 papers). Rocío Bengoechea is often cited by papers focused on RNA Research and Splicing (12 papers), Muscle Physiology and Disorders (8 papers) and Heat shock proteins research (6 papers). Rocío Bengoechea collaborates with scholars based in Spain, United States and United Kingdom. Rocío Bengoechea's co-authors include Miguel Lafarga, Marı́a T. Berciano, O. Tapia, Íñigo Casafont, Vanesa Lafarga, Ana Cuadrado, Óscar Fernández-Capetillo, Isabel López de Silanes, Ángel R. Nebreda and Conrad C. Weihl and has published in prestigious journals such as Journal of Biological Chemistry, Journal of Clinical Investigation and PLoS ONE.
